Manorama Industries Limited has announced that its Board of Directors will meet on March 12, 2026, to consider fundraising through the issuance of securities. The proposal may include equity shares, convertible instruments, or qualified institutional placements, with shareholder approval sought via a postal ballot.

Board Meeting Intimation
The company formally disclosed the upcoming meeting under SEBI’s listing regulations. The agenda centers on evaluating capital infusion strategies to support growth initiatives and strengthen financial flexibility. This move reflects the company’s intent to tap capital markets for expansion and operational needs.
Fundraising Options Under Consideration
Manorama Industries is exploring multiple fundraising avenues, including equity issuance and convertible instruments. Qualified institutional placement (QIP) is also on the table, offering a route to attract institutional investors while adhering to regulatory norms. The final decision will depend on market conditions and shareholder consent.
Strategic Implications
A successful fundraising exercise could enhance liquidity, reduce leverage, and provide resources for scaling operations. It also signals confidence in the company’s long-term growth trajectory, aligning with broader industry trends where firms are bolstering capital structures to navigate volatility.
